akin |
similar in kind or spirit; alike. |
appreciation |
a feeling of thanks. |
assurance |
a statement meant to give confidence. |
asylum |
a place that offers safety. |
authentic |
real, genuine, or true. |
circulate |
to move or flow along a closed path or system. |
circumstance |
a condition or fact connected with or having an effect on an event or situation. |
corruption |
activity that is not honest, especially secret, illegal activity. |
covenant |
a usually formal agreement between two or more parties to engage in or refrain from something. |
dependable |
deserving trust or confidence; able to be counted on. |
editor |
a person who reads and corrects materials for publication. |
fathom |
to get to the bottom of or understand completely. |
inflame |
to stir up or intensify. |
subscribe |
to agree to pay for a certain number of issues of a publication such as a magazine. |
surprisingly |
in a way or in an amount that is not expected. |
